For mobile operators, the outlook for 6G from a spectrum perspective is unfamiliar. They are eyeing frequencies in the UHF, upper 6 GHz, 7-8 GHz and mmWave bands, but they are not alone. This is the first generational cycle where exclusivity is no longer guaranteed for mobile operators. It is… Read more...
